Can some one tell me if the Toy Story rooms at All-star Movies is preffered rooms or not, because some web sites say that only fantasia is and some say that toy story is as well.
Any help would be helpful thanks.
 
Up until last April, Fantasia was the only preferred section at ASMo. Then they changed it so that Toy Story and Dalmatians were also classed as preferred buildings. We booked last April (before it changed) and requested Dalmatians. Checked-in in October, got Dalmatians and also got charged for preferred - thanks Disney :rolleyes:

Sorry, I digressed - to answer your question, yes, Toy Story is preferred :)

Just found this on disneyworld.com

All rooms have two double beds, table and chairs, a vanity area with sink, and a separate bathroom with tub. Preferred Rooms are located in the two Fantasia Buildings located nearer to the main pool, food court, transportation, playground and laundry facilities. Non-smoking and disabled-accessible rooms are available. Amenities include in-room wall safe, voice mail and data port on phone. Hairdryer, iron, ironing board and refrigerator are available upon request.

Interesting that I couldn't find that info on disneyworld.com but I did fid this on www.allears.net

Preferred rooms are located in the buildings closest to Cinema Hall: Toy Story, Fantasia, and 101 Dalmatians.

Link to the allears info here

ETA: From this thread it appears that the info on disneyworld.com is incorrect - as I sadi the toy Story and Dalmatians buildings are now preferred as of May 1st 2006.
 


When I went to book All-Star movies a few weeks ago, the CM said all that was available was preferred rooms. I did ask which buildings were preferred and he said Toy Story and Fantasia and that he and his family prefer Toy Story Buzz rooms...
